What makes this particular car so special you might ask.....In 1978, Volkswagen began producing the North American "Rabbit" version of the Mk1 Golf at its Westmoreland plant. Former Chevrolet engineer James McLernon was chosen to run the factory, which was built to lower the cost of the Rabbit in North America by producing it locally. Unfortunately, McLernon tried to "Americanize" the Golf/Rabbit (Volkswagen executive Werner Schmidt referred to the act as "Malibuing" the car) by softening the suspension and using cheaper materials for the interior.[citation needed] VW purists in America and company executives in Germany were displeased,[citation needed] and for the 1983 model year the Pennsylvania plant went back to using stiffer shocks and suspension with higher-quality interior trim.[citation needed] The plant also began producing the GTI for the North American market. ('Rabbits' were built in Pennsylvania until 1984).
